The ideal listening position for 6-channel surround playback is the point at equal distance from all speakers.

By setting the delay time for the center and surround speakers, this item realizes the ideal listening position virtually.

(The center and surround speakers can be set as if they are laid out on the dotted line circle shown below.)

How to set the delay time

Delay time setting sets the delay time converted to the

distance from the speaker to the listening position.

The front speakers (L/R) can be adjusted between 40 feet

(12 m) and 3 feet (0.9 m).

The range which can be set for the center speaker (C) and
the surround speakers (LS/RS) differs according to the

setting for the front speakers. A longer distance than for

the front speakers can not be set.
